With the three-unit server rack mount, you can mount up to three Cloud Link Roadrunner™ units on a server rack in the
enclosure.
What you should know
- The three-unit server rack mount fits 19-inch (482.6 mm) server racks and requires
one full-width rack unit (1U).
- Screws for securing the three-unit mount to the server rack are not provided. The
mounting flange holes accept screws up to M6 (¼-20).
- If you will not have access to the back of the unit after it is mounted because of
the enclosure configuration or mounting location, you can make the wire connections
to the terminals, then connect the terminals to the unit. Alternatively, you can
complete all of the wiring, then mount the Cloud Link Roadrunner unit.
Procedure
-
Attach a ground terminal to the side of the unit using one of the provided screws
(pan-head with integrated washer).
NOTE:
- Install the terminal between the screw head and the washer.
- Tighten the screw until the washer is compressed.
- The side of the unit has limited accessibility after installation.
-
Remove the two screws (pan-head with integrated washer) from the left side of the
unit.
IMPORTANT: Only remove the screws from one side of the unit at a time.
The screws secure the unit's cover to the chassis.
-
Attach a rack mount flange using two of the provided flat-head screws.
IMPORTANT: Ensure that the screws are fully tightened.
NOTE: The mounting flange is reversible.
-
Using the same instructions, attach a flange to the right side of the unit.
-
Slide the unit into the rack and secure it with the two pan-head screws. Tighten
the screws until the integrated washers are compressed.
